How to prepare for a job interview at Academics Ltd.
✨Know Your Stuff
Make sure you understand the role of a Qualified Teaching Assistant inside out. Familiarise yourself with the EYFS, Key Stage 1, and Key Stage 2 curriculums. This will help you answer questions confidently and show that you're ready to support teaching and learning effectively.
✨Show Your Passion
During the interview, let your enthusiasm for working with children shine through. Share specific examples of how you've positively impacted students' lives in the past. This will demonstrate your commitment to making a difference and your nurturing approach.
✨Team Player Vibes
Highlight your ability to work well within a team. Discuss experiences where you've collaborated with teachers, staff, or families to support students. This shows that you can communicate effectively and contribute to a positive school environment.
✨Behaviour Management Know-How
Be prepared to discuss your behaviour management strategies. Share examples of how you've handled challenging situations with patience and care. This will reassure the interviewers that you have the skills to maintain a supportive and safe learning environment.
